Søndre Nordstrand (Southern Nordstrand) is a borough of the city of Oslo, Norway. It is the southernmost borough of Oslo, bordering Nordstrand. As of 2020 it has 39,066 inhabitants[1] and the highest rate of immigrant population at 56%.[2] It is the only borough of Oslo that has a majority-minority population.[3]
